Flame retardant knitted fabrics
Aramid fibers are aromatic polyamides whose crystalline parts and stretched molecule chains lead to a high temperature resistance.
BLÜCHER SYSTEMS® Hydro protects against flames according to EN 532 with code A, B2, C1, and according to ISO 6941. This means that the material does not drip, melt or continue to burn.
The manikin was dressed and tested with two different underwear. On top of the underwear a battle dress uniform made of Polyester / cotton was placed. By means of 12 burners, a fire flash was simulated. Sensors determined the heat at the skin as well as the grade of the burnings.
In the film it is shown that BLÜCHER SYSTEMS® Hydro leads to minor burnings in comparison to standard cotton underwear.
The pictures taken after the test show that the cotton underwear is vastly burned while BLÜCHER SYSTEMS® Hydro is hardly damaged and relatively still in one piece.
